专为小企业定制的小众开票软件解决方案,通常需要满足这些企业的特殊需求,如成本效益、易用性、可扩展性和安全性。以下是一些关键要素和步骤,用于设计这样的解决方案:
1. 确定目标用户和业务需求
- 用户调研:通过问卷调查、一对一访谈等方式收集用户的基本信息和业务特点。
- 需求分析:深入理解用户在开票过程中遇到的具体问题,如发票管理、财务对账、税务申报等。
2. 选择合适的技术平台
- 开源与商业方案比较:评估开源方案与商业软件的成本效益,考虑长远维护和支持。
- 云服务考量:如果预算允许,考虑使用云计算服务,以实现数据备份、弹性伸缩和远程访问。
3. 设计用户界面
- 直观性:界面设计应简洁明了,减少用户操作步骤,提高上手速度。
- 响应式设计:确保软件在不同设备上均能良好显示,适应移动办公需求。
4. 功能定制开发
- 核心功能:根据用户需求定制发票开具、查询、统计、打印等功能。
- 集成第三方服务:如银行接口、税控系统等,确保与企业现有系统无缝对接。
5. 安全性与合规性
- 数据加密:所有传输和存储的数据必须加密,以防数据泄露。
- 权限控制:设置不同级别的用户权限,限制敏感数据的访问。
- 合规检查:确保软件符合当地税法、商业法规和行业标准。
6. 测试与反馈
- 单元测试:对每个模块进行单独测试,确保其按预期工作。
- 集成测试:模拟多模块协同工作时的工作流程,确保整体流程顺畅无阻。
- 用户测试:邀请实际用户参与测试,收集改进意见。
7. 部署与培训
- 逐步部署:从小规模开始,逐步扩大到整个企业。
- 用户培训:提供详细的使用手册和在线帮助文档,安排面对面或线上培训课程。
8. 持续支持与更新
- 技术支持:建立快速响应的技术支持体系,解决用户在使用过程中遇到的问题。
- 定期更新:随着技术的发展,定期更新软件以修复漏洞、增加新功能。
9. 性能优化
- 负载测试:模拟高负载情况下软件的表现,确保在高峰时段仍能稳定运行。
- 优化数据库:定期清理和优化数据库,提高查询效率和数据吞吐量。
10. 成本效益分析
- 预算对比:将软件成本与人工成本、时间成本等进行对比,确保投资回报率合理。
- 长期视角:考虑软件升级和维护费用,确保长期可持续使用。
总之,通过上述步骤,可以为小企业打造一个既符合其特定需求又具备强大功能和良好用户体验的小众开票软件解决方案。